Dec 4, 2009 #1 Eric Noa Reefing newb How long do you have to wait before you can put water where you just recently used silicone?
Dec 4, 2009 #2 H Hiker4twenty Reef enthusiast 24hrs....but 48 is much better. About a month ago I built a 10g fuge for my brother. After 24hrs I did a leak test, resealed and then left sit another 48hrs. Did another leak test and I'm good to go. Last edited: Dec 4, 2009

Dec 4, 2009 #3 Bifferwine I am a girl 24 hours is how long it takes to cure. You can speed that up by aiming a fan at it.
